Power is changing shape. Cars are becoming computers on wheels. Electric grids are learning how to store sunlight and wind. And behind all of it is one metal that has turned into a global obsession: lithium.
Lithium Rising is a clear, story-driven guide to why lithium matters in 2026, why the market swings so hard, and why the real battle is not only about digging more out of the ground. It is about turning raw material into battery-grade chemicals, building reliable supply chains, and keeping up with a world that wants more batteries every year.
If you have ever wondered what people mean when they say the world is in a lithium battery revolution, this book is for you. You will understand what is pushing demand, what is slowing supply, and why the headlines often miss the most important part of the story: conversion, refining, and the industrial steps between a mine and a battery factory. You will also see why lithium is not only an EV story anymore. The rise of grid batteries and backup power is reshaping the market, making energy storage technology a major driver of the new cycle.
Inside these pages, you will get a simple and practical electric vehicle battery guide to how batteries are made, how supply chains work, and what changes when automakers choose different chemistries. You will learn the real meaning of lithium supply chain explained in plain English, from mining and concentrate to conversion, cathodes, cells, and packs.
You will also take a sober look at the market itself. What does “spot price” mean compared to contract pricing? Why can prices jump and crash even when demand is rising? What signals actually matter in the lithium industry analysis? If you have been trying to follow the lithium market 2026 story without getting lost in noise, this book gives you a clear path through it.
Because lithium is now treated as a strategic resource, the book also maps the geopolitical race to control processing, refining, and capacity. You will see how nations and companies are building for the future of electric vehicles, and why many plans focus on moving beyond mining into lithium mining and processing that can support local production at scale. The result is a global build-out where the global battery industry is expanding fast, but not always smoothly.
This is not a hype book. It is a practical guide for curious readers who want to understand how the modern battery economy works.
